Detect, confirm, update, and respond to scheduled and unscheduled traffic and incident management events on the arterial network, congestion, and travel time imbalances in the geographical coverage area
Follow FDOT District 4 policies and procedures, including the District 4 TSM&O SOP
Coordinate with other Control Room staff, law enforcement, and external agencies in response to incidents
Dispatch SIRVs to motorists, events, and to assist law enforcement in a timely and efficient manner
Coordinate with maintenance staff as needed
Follow time requirements in the District 4 TSM&O SOP for event confirmation, RRSP and SIRV dispatching, etc.
Monitor the status of arterial network using CCTV, SIRV, Road Ranger Service Patrols (future), detector data, Bluetooth devices, etc.
Detect, confirm, and report equipment faults affecting Control Room equipment and field equipment, including equipment maintained by the signal timing agency
Act as essential personnel during emergency events as needed to support MTC operations’ needs
Perform daily Arterial ITS infrastructure checks (CCTVs, DMS, MVDS, Video Wall, etc.) early in the mornings and open ITS device failure tickets for malfunctions detected during the check
Coordinate with signal timing staff and county or city/municipality staff as required to adjust signal timing as needed in response to scheduled and unscheduled events
Enter all scheduled and unscheduled events and congestion into SunGuide software
Disseminate information using ITS devices, website, and Florida 511 system
